The SFH4646 from OSRAM Opto Semiconductors is an infrared (IR) emitter designed for use in a variety of applications including remote control, light barriers, and optical sensors. It emits infrared light at a wavelength of 950 nm and is housed in a compact package. The device is designed for efficient and reliable performance in various operating conditions.

The SFH4646 has a typical forward voltage of 1.5 V and a radiant intensity of around 20 mW/sr. Its narrow viewing angle allows for focused and efficient transmission of infrared light to corresponding receivers. The fast switching times enable its use in applications requiring quick response. The 950 nm wavelength ensures compatibility with a wide range of silicon-based phototransistors and photodiodes. The compact package makes it suitable for space-constrained applications.
